python网络编程
林熙
这个作者很懒,什么都没留下…
展开
-
Python完成文件传输
原理:用python编写tftp客户端,实现从tftp服务器上下载文件(基于UDP协议传输)一、什么是tftp?TFTP(Trivial File Transfer Protocol,简单文件传输协议)是TCP/IP协议族中的一个用来在客户机与服务器之间进行简单文件传输的协议,提供不复杂、开销不大的文件传输服务。端口号为69。二、tftp服务器、客户端传输原理1、首先,客户端发送一个读写请...原创 2019-01-28 18:03:27 · 12965 阅读 · 1 评论 -
Python用socket、多线程实现一对一聊天室
一、基于udp协议1、通信原理主机A -----发:hello----- 主机BHello由应用层往下包装:主机A:应用层:hello传输层:将传输协议(UDP)与 hello 包装 网络层:将IP地址、传输协议(UDP)、hello 包装链路层:将MAC(网卡地址)、IP地址、传输协议(UDP)、hello 包装主机B:链路层:MAC(网卡地址)、IP地址、传输协议(UDP)...原创 2019-01-23 15:55:51 · 2269 阅读 · 0 评论 -
编写一个简单的Web静态服务器
import socketimport reimport structfrom multiprocessing import Process#静态文件根目录HTML_ROOT_DIR = "./html"class HTTPServer(object): """Web服务器对象""" def __init__(self): self.server_...原创 2019-03-03 10:29:22 · 426 阅读 · 0 评论